|
터가 10001101이라 할 때 번호를 부여하여 다항식으로 표현하면 (그림 4)와 같다.
그림 4을 보면 알 수 있듯이 각 자리에 1이 들어있는 자릿수를 X의 지수로 정한다.
그림 4
3. CRC 비트를 만드는 방법
우선 알아 두어야 할 것이 있다. CRC에 서 사용하
|
- 페이지 13페이지
- 가격 2,000원
- 등록일 2009.11.16
- 파일종류 한글(hwp)
- 참고문헌 있음
- 최근 2주 판매 이력 없음
|
|
%08s ", bitSeq);
}
for( i = 0; i < 4; ++i )
{
printf("00000000 ");
}
printf("\n");
crc = CRCGENERATOR(data, sizeData);// CRC 생성구문 사용
ltoa(crc, bitSeq, 2);
printf("Remainder: %032s\n", bitSeq);// 송신에서 구한 CRC 출력
data[sizeData] = (unsigned char) ((crc >> 24) & 0x000000FF);// 데이
|
- 페이지 14페이지
- 가격 4,000원
- 등록일 2008.03.07
- 파일종류 한글(hwp)
- 참고문헌 없음
- 최근 2주 판매 이력 없음
|
|
유무를 카운팅해서 화면상에 뿌려주고, 연산되는 과정의 중간값들을 텍스트 파일로 저장해서 알수있게 작성을 했습니다. 1) 보고서 ppt
2) parity check
3) crc-8 오류검증
4) crc-8 modulo-2 연산 과정
5) crc-32 오류검증
6) crc-32 modulo-2 연산 과정
|
- 페이지 16페이지
- 가격 2,000원
- 등록일 2010.04.16
- 파일종류 압축파일
- 참고문헌 있음
- 최근 2주 판매 이력 없음
|
|
CRC 값을 검사한다.
* 알고리즘에 따라 CRC 값을 검사하고 remainder를 생성한다..
*/
int CheckCRC(char *remainder)
{
int i;
int j;
for(i = 0; i < strlen(message); i++)
remainder[i] = message[i];
remainder[strlen(message) + 32] = '\0';
for(i = 0; i < strlen(message); i++)
{
if(remainder[0] ==
|
- 페이지 30페이지
- 가격 5,000원
- 등록일 2010.01.18
- 파일종류 한글(hwp)
- 참고문헌 있음
- 최근 2주 판매 이력 없음
|
|
int main(void)
{
int num;
printf(" CRC Encoding & Decoding Program\n\n");
printf(" 1 . Encoding\n");
printf(" 2 . Decoding\n");
printf(" 3 . Load Text File\n");
printf(" 4 . Program Exit\n\n");
printf(" 메뉴를 선택하세요 : ");
if(
|
- 페이지 10페이지
- 가격 10,000원
- 등록일 2008.11.19
- 파일종류 기타
- 참고문헌 없음
- 최근 2주 판매 이력 없음
|